    What Is Adult ADHD?

    ADHD is a neurodevelopmental condition that manifests in symptoms such as negligence, impulsivity, and hyperactivity. While it’s commonly identified in children, adults can likewise experience these symptoms, which might cause troubles in relationships, work performance, and general lifestyle.     Symptoms of Adult ADHD

    Adults with ADHD may show a variety of symptoms. Here are some common signs:

    • Inattention: Difficulty focusing on jobs, bad company, and lapse of memory.
    • Impulsivity: Interrupting conversations, making rash decisions, and acting without considering effects.
    • Uneasyness: Persistent feelings of restlessness, leading to difficulties sitting still or relaxing.
    • Difficulty following through: Inability to finish jobs, especially those that appear mundane or boring.
    • Emotional volatility: Intense sensations of aggravation, anger, or sadness, typically disproportionate to the scenario.

    Impact of Adult ADHD

    The results of neglected adult ADHD can be extensive, influencing different spheres of life:

    • Career: Challenges with time management and company can hinder job performance.
    • Relationships: Impulsivity and inattentiveness may result in misunderstandings and conflicts.
    • Mental Health: Individuals may experience increased rates of anxiety, anxiety, and drug abuse.

    The Role of Online ADHD Tests

    With the expansion of technology, online platforms have actually ended up being a practical method for individuals to examine whether they may have adult ADHD. These tests are generally created to screen for symptoms based upon self-reported experiences and habits.

    Advantages of Taking Online Tests

    1. Accessibility: Available anytime, assisting those who may not have simple access to healthcare resources.
    2. Privacy: Offers a personal method to explore symptoms without the pressure of an in-person assessment.
    3. Immediate Feedback: Users often receive outcomes quickly, permitting quicker decision-making about seeking additional assessment.

    Limitations of Online Tests

    While online tests can provide useful insights, they are not conclusive diagnoses. Limitations consist of:

    • Lack of Professional Guidance: Many tests do not take into consideration private scenarios or co-occurring conditions.
    • Variable Reliability: The quality and method of online tests can vary substantially.
    • Prospective Misinterpretation: Users might misinterpret their results, causing unneeded anxiety or baseless conclusions.

    Types of Online ADHD Tests

    Online ADHD tests differ commonly in format and rigor. Some common types include:

    • Self-Assessment Questionnaires: Series of yes/no or multiple-choice concerns connected to ADHD symptoms.
    • Behavioral Checklists: Lists of habits to examine the frequency and seriousness of observed symptoms.
    • Validated Scales: Tests established from scientific research study, designed to screen for ADHD (like the ASRS).

    What to Do After Taking an Online ADHD Test

    After finishing an online test, individuals are frequently left wondering what their next actions ought to be. Here are some choices to consider:

    1. Consult a Mental Health Professional: If the online assessment shows a probability of ADHD, a professional evaluation is suggested.
    2. Inform Yourself: Research more about adult ADHD to much better understand the condition.
    3. Join Support Groups: Connecting with others who experience comparable difficulties can be helpful.
    4. Think About Lifestyle Changes: Implement methods like company tools and mindfulness practices that may support symptom management.

    Potential Questions and Answers (FAQs)

    Q: Can an online ADHD test supply a precise diagnosis?A: No, onlinetests are not replacements for an expert medical diagnosis. They can show whether additional evaluation is needed. Q: Are online tests for ADHD reliable?A: The dependability of online tests can differ. It is advisable to search for tests related to respectable companies or that utilize medically verified techniques. Q: What should I do if my test outcome recommends ADHD?A: Consider seeking advice from a doctor who can perform a thorough assessment and go over possible treatment options. Q: Is ADHD treatment offered for adults?A: Yes, treatments such as therapy, medication, and lifestyle modifications can effectively handle adult ADHD symptoms.
